​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​Gemini Expands EU Offerings with Staking and Perpetuals                                                                            

CoinDesk: Crypto Exchange Gemini Expands EU Offering With Staking, Perpetuals

CoinDesk: Crypto Exchange Gemini Expands EU Offering With Staking, Perpetuals

In the dynamic world of cryptocurrency, exchanges are continually adapting to meet user demands and regulatory landscapes. Gemini, a prominent crypto platform, has made a significant move by expanding its services in the European Union. According to a recent CoinDesk report, this expansion includes new staking options and perpetuals, designed to enhance accessibility and rewards for EU-based users.

What’s Driving Gemini’s Expansion?

Gemini’s latest update comes as the crypto market grows, with more users seeking ways to maximize their holdings. The exchange is responding to this trend by introducing staking services that allow users to earn rewards on popular cryptocurrencies like Ether (ETH) and Solana (SOL). This is particularly timely in the EU, where regulatory clarity around crypto activities has been improving, making it easier for platforms like Gemini to innovate.

At its core, staking involves locking up cryptocurrency to support blockchain networks, in return for rewards. Gemini’s offering stands out because it requires no minimum amount, lowering the barrier for entry. This means even small-scale investors can participate, potentially democratizing access to staking rewards.

Key Features of the New Staking Service

Let’s break down the specifics. The staking service supports Ether and Solana, two of the most active blockchains in the ecosystem. Here are the highlights:

  • No minimum deposit required, making it inclusive for beginners and casual investors.
  • Users can earn rewards based on the performance of the underlying networks, providing a passive income stream.
  • Perpetuals, another addition, offer leveraged trading options without expiration dates, appealing to those looking for advanced trading tools.

This expansion not only broadens Gemini’s appeal but also aligns with the growing interest in decentralized finance (DeFi) activities across Europe. By eliminating barriers like minimum stakes, Gemini is positioning itself as a user-friendly alternative in a competitive market.

Potential Impact on the Crypto Community

For EU residents, this development could mean easier entry into staking, which has traditionally favored larger investors. As more people participate, it might boost liquidity and network security for Ether and Solana. However, users should always consider risks like market volatility and regulatory changes when engaging in staking or trading.

Takeaway: A Step Toward Inclusive Crypto Growth

Gemini’s EU expansion with staking and perpetuals is a smart play that could accelerate crypto adoption by making rewards more accessible. This move highlights how exchanges are adapting to user needs, potentially setting a benchmark for others. If you’re in the EU and interested in staking, this could be an opportunity to start small and build your portfolio.

​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​Dogecoin Price Forms $0.21-$0.22 Range Amid Institutional Surge                                                                                                                        

CoinDesk: Dogecoin Price Analysis: $0.21–$0.22 Range Forms as Institutional Flows Spike

CoinDesk: Dogecoin Price Analysis: $0.21–$0.22 Range Forms as Institutional Flows Spike

Introduction to Dogecoin’s Latest Market Moves

Dogecoin, the popular memecoin that started as a joke, continues to surprise the crypto world with its volatility. Recent analysis from CoinDesk highlights a key price range forming between $0.21 and $0.22, driven by a surge in institutional flows. This activity underscores the growing interest from larger investors in even the most lighthearted cryptocurrencies.

The Rally and Subsequent Pullback

The memecoin experienced a notable rally, pushing its price up to $0.22. This upward movement was largely fueled by increased institutional investments, which injected fresh capital and momentum into the market. Such flows often signal broader confidence in assets like Dogecoin, even amidst its reputation for meme-driven speculation.

However, the gains were short-lived. Profit-taking by early buyers and late-session selling pressure quickly reversed the trend, driving the price back toward the $0.21 support level. This pattern is common in volatile markets, where rapid inflows can lead to equally swift outflows as traders secure their profits.

Key Factors Influencing Dogecoin’s Price

Institutional flows represent a significant shift for Dogecoin, which has traditionally been influenced by retail traders and social media hype. The spike suggests that major players are diversifying into alternative coins, potentially viewing Dogecoin as a high-risk, high-reward option. On the flip side, profit-taking highlights the inherent risks of such assets, where prices can swing based on sentiment and market timing.

Analysts point to broader market conditions, including overall crypto sentiment and regulatory news, as contributing factors. For instance, any positive developments in the memecoin space could reinforce this range, while negative events might break it.

Takeaway for Investors

The $0.21–$0.22 range for Dogecoin serves as a reminder of the crypto market’s unpredictability, especially for memecoins. While institutional interest can drive short-term gains, it’s crucial for investors to monitor for signs of volatility, such as profit-taking, to make informed decisions. This event emphasizes the importance of diversification and risk management in a portfolio.

​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​Bitcoin Hovers at $110K, Awaiting Friday’s Data Upside                                                                                                                                        

CoinDesk: Bitcoin Floats Around $110K as Traders Look Toward Friday Data for Upside

CoinDesk: Bitcoin Floats Around $110K as Traders Look Toward Friday Data for Upside

The Current State of Bitcoin

In the ever-volatile world of cryptocurrencies, Bitcoin has been hovering around the $110,000 mark, drawing keen interest from traders worldwide. According to recent reports from CoinDesk, this stability comes amid broader economic signals that could influence future price movements.

Economic Factors at Play

A weaker U.S. jobs market is making headlines, as it bolsters arguments for potential monetary easing by central banks. This development has led some investors to view hard assets like Bitcoin as a safe haven. Hard assets, which include cryptocurrencies, gold, and other tangible stores of value, often gain appeal during times of economic uncertainty.

Traders are particularly focused on upcoming data releases, with Friday’s reports expected to provide fresh insights into the U.S. economy. If the data confirms a slowdown, it could spark further upside for Bitcoin, as more investors seek protection from traditional market risks.

Why Investors Are Turning to Bitcoin

Experts suggest that Bitcoin’s appeal lies in its decentralized nature and limited supply, making it a popular choice for hedging against inflation and economic instability. For instance, some analysts point out that as fiat currencies face pressures from easing policies, digital assets like Bitcoin could see increased demand.

To break it down, here are key reasons why this trend is emerging:

  • Economic easing often devalues currencies, pushing investors toward alternatives like Bitcoin.
  • A weaker jobs market signals potential recessions, historically boosting interest in hard assets.
  • Friday’s data could act as a catalyst, influencing trader sentiment and driving price surges.

Takeaway for Crypto Enthusiasts

As Bitcoin maintains its position around $110,000, the coming days could be pivotal for the market. This scenario underscores the importance of staying informed about macroeconomic indicators and their impact on cryptocurrencies. For investors, this might be a reminder to diversify portfolios and monitor economic data closely for potential opportunities.

Ultimately, while Bitcoin’s future depends on various factors, current trends suggest that economic headwinds could propel it higher, making it a topic worth watching in the weeks ahead.

​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​Ethena’s BlackRock-Backed Proposal for Hyperliquid Stablecoin                              

CoinDesk: Ethena Joins Race for Hyperliquid’s Stablecoin With BlackRock-Backed Proposal

CoinDesk: Ethena Joins Race for Hyperliquid's Stablecoin With BlackRock-Backed Proposal

Introduction

In the ever-evolving crypto landscape, competition for stablecoin dominance is heating up. Ethena, a key player in the decentralized finance (DeFi) space, has entered the race to develop a stablecoin for Hyperliquid, a prominent trading platform. This move is backed by BlackRock, the global investment giant, adding significant weight to the proposal as reported by CoinDesk.

The Proposal Details

Ethena’s stablecoin initiative aims to integrate seamlessly with Hyperliquid’s ecosystem. At its core, the proposal promises to return 95% of the generated revenue back to Hyperliquid’s users and stakeholders. This revenue-sharing model could enhance liquidity and rewards within the platform, making it an attractive option for traders and investors.

BlackRock’s involvement highlights the growing interest from traditional finance in crypto innovations. Their backing suggests potential for greater stability and institutional-grade features, which could set this stablecoin apart from competitors.

Broader Implications for the Crypto Market

Stablecoins like the one Ethena is proposing play a crucial role in DeFi by providing a reliable medium for transactions and hedging against volatility. If successful, this could boost Hyperliquid’s adoption and foster more collaborative efforts between DeFi projects and established financial institutions.

However, the crypto community will be watching closely to see how this proposal unfolds, especially regarding regulatory compliance and real-world implementation. As the race intensifies, it underscores the ongoing innovation in stablecoin designs aimed at maximizing ecosystem benefits.

Key Takeaway

This development from Ethena, with BlackRock’s support, exemplifies how revenue-sharing mechanisms can drive value back to users in the DeFi space. For investors and enthusiasts, it signals a maturing market where strategic partnerships could lead to more sustainable and rewarding opportunities. Stay tuned as this story evolves.

​​​​​​​U.S. Energy Chief Slams Net Zero by 2050 as ‘Colossal Train Wreck’              

International: Top News And Analysis: ‘A Colossal Train Wreck’: U.S. Energy Chief Slams Odds of Net Zero by 2050

International: Top News And Analysis: 'A colossal train wreck': U.S. energy chief slams odds of net zero by 2050

The Context of Net Zero by 2050

The goal of achieving net zero carbon emissions by 2050 has been a cornerstone of global climate efforts, championed by organizations like the United Nations and various governments. This target aims to limit global warming by balancing greenhouse gas emissions with removals. However, recent statements from key figures in the energy sector are raising doubts about its feasibility.

In a bold critique, U.S. Energy Secretary Chris Wright described the net zero ambition as “a colossal train wreck,” highlighting potential economic and practical challenges. His comments, made in an interview, underscore growing tensions between environmental goals and real-world energy demands.

Breaking Down Chris Wright’s Statement

According to reports from CNBC, Wright labeled net zero by 2050 as “a monstrous human impoverishment program” that is unlikely to succeed. He argued that the rapid transition required would impose significant burdens on economies, potentially leading to widespread poverty and instability.

Wright’s remarks stem from concerns over the scale of infrastructure changes needed, including shifts in energy production, transportation, and industry. For instance, replacing fossil fuels with renewables at the pace required could strain resources and increase costs for consumers and businesses alike.

Challenges and Realities of Achieving Net Zero

Achieving net zero involves decarbonizing major sectors like energy, agriculture, and manufacturing. Experts point to obstacles such as technological limitations, high implementation costs, and geopolitical factors. For example, the reliance on rare earth minerals for solar panels and batteries has raised questions about supply chain sustainability.

In the U.S., the transition is further complicated by domestic energy policies and the country’s heavy dependence on oil and gas. Wright’s skepticism echoes broader debates, with some analysts warning that aggressive timelines could disrupt global markets without adequate alternatives in place.

Implications for Global Energy and Policy

This criticism from a high-profile official like Wright could influence international climate negotiations and domestic policies. It might prompt a reevaluation of timelines, emphasizing innovation in areas like carbon capture or nuclear energy as bridges to net zero.

For industries tied to energy, such as cryptocurrency mining—which often relies on significant power resources—this debate highlights potential risks. Increased energy costs or policy shifts could impact operational efficiency, making it crucial for stakeholders to monitor developments closely.

Key Takeaway

Chris Wright’s stark assessment serves as a reminder that while the net zero goal is ambitious, it faces substantial hurdles that could delay or alter its path. This underscores the need for balanced approaches that weigh environmental benefits against economic realities, encouraging ongoing dialogue and innovation in energy solutions.
